Google Pixel 10: AI that actually reads your mind & psychic phone features

Pixel 10 AI that actually gets you. Your phone just got psychic. Google dropped the Pixel 10 this week. And trust me, it's not just another upgrade. This is when AI stops being a gimmick and actually starts being useful in your life. Here's the issue with phones in 2025. We've got too many apps. Planning a simple dinner? You're bouncing between messages, Gmail, maps, reservation apps, and other things. You spend more time searching for stuff than actually getting things done. Enter the Tensor G5 chip. This one's made by TSMC, not Samsung, and it changes everything. Magic Q connects the dots across all your apps, Gmail, calendar, screenshots, messages, and just knows what you need. It pulls up the relevant info and suggests actions before you even realize you need them. Tech reviewer Max Vinebach called it one of the coolest things he's seen. Android Police's editor said, "Magicu could change the way I think about AI. It was an annoyance before, but now it changes everything. I love it. " But here's where it gets wild. Voice translate breaks down language barriers during phone calls. With Tensor G5, the AI translates your conversation in real time, and you still hear the other person's voice. It's like Star Trek, but real. Tom's Guide tested it out. His voice was in English on my end, but my replies were in German on his end, and it was still my voice, not some weird assistant voice. Seriously, this is next level stuff. And the camera, it's got a coach now. Camera Coach uses Gemini models to give you tips before you even snap the shot. It'll suggest things like better lighting, better angles, or even asking your subject to look at the camera. It's like having a professional photographer in your pocket. The numbers speak for themselves. 34% faster CPU performance with huge gains in both single and multi-threaded tasks. AI tasks, a 60% performance boost. The Tensor G5 chip powers over 20 ondevice AI features right out the gate. And it's not just about phones. Google's launching Gemini for Home in October, replacing Google Assistant on speakers and displays. You can now say, "Turn off the lights everywhere except my bedroom. " And it'll actually get what you mean. No more vague commands. The Pixel 10 is available for pre-order now, and it's hitting shelves August 28th, starting at $799. It's got features that were straight up sci-fi just last year, update number three. We're at the dawn

Boston Dynamics Atlas + Figure 02: Robots that learn, adapt, and converse

seven, Boston Dynamics Atlas plus figure robots. Let's talk about robots. Atlas is that robot you've seen doing crazy stuff like parkour or lifting heavy things. 12 years ago, it couldn't even walk upstairs without falling. This week, Atlas is holding conversations and even reorganizing factory floors. Here's the big leap. Boston Dynamics and Toyota cracked the code. Atlas now runs on large behavior models. basically a huge neural network that can control 28 different movements at the same time. In a demo, Atlas was doing tasks like a pro, assembling stuff in a spot workshop, all from simple English commands. And when researchers purposely interfered by sliding boxes or closing lids, Atlas adapted in real time. Scott Quindesma from Boston Dynamics calls it training a single neural network to perform many long horizon manipulation tasks. Translation: It's like teaching Atlas a bunch of new tricks at once. Here's where it gets even cooler. Before, robots like Atlas had to separate walking from doing stuff with their hands. But now, Atlas treats its hands and feet the same way. One brain controlling everything. So, it can walk, crouch, manipulate parts, regrasp things, and still keep its balance. And then there's Figure 02. While Atlas figured out how to think, Figure move using reinforcement learning, basically AI learning by trial and error across thousands of virtual robots. They made the robot walk just like us. Heel strikes, tow offs, synchronized arm swings. Figure went from walking at 17% of human speed to 2. 68 mph in just one year. And these robots are already earning revenue at BMW's South Carolina plant. What's next? Atlas will be working at Hyundai factory starting in 2026. Tesla's Optimus, they're aiming to deliver 10,000 units this year. Update number eight, Google

Google Docs Audio Playback: Listen to documents aloud with Gemini AI

Docs can read your document to you. Google just solved one of writing's oldest problems, catching your own mistakes. Now, Google Docs can read your documents aloud through Gemini AI. Just go to tools, audio, listen to this tab, and boom, up pops a floating player with natural sounding voices. And the best part, the voices sound genuinely human. This is a game changer for proofreading. Your ears catch things your eyes might miss. It's perfect for learning on your commute, making documents accessible, or simply multitasking. This feature powered by Gemini AI launched on August 18th and is currently available in English only. But this isn't just about convenience. It's making content consumption far more accessible. Documents now they're practically audiobooks. Sometimes the best features are the simplest ones. Update number
